diff --git a/css/30_highways.css b/css/30_highways.css index 76505ebf0..56920c56c 100644 --- a/css/30_highways.css +++ b/css/30_highways.css @@ -13,10 +13,11 @@ path.stroke.tag-highway { /* highway areas */ -path.stroke.area.tag-highway { +path.stroke.area.tag-highway, +.low-zoom path.stroke.area.tag-highway { stroke: #fff; stroke-dasharray: none; - stroke-width: 2; + stroke-width: 1; } /* wide highways */ diff --git a/css/35_aeroways.css b/css/35_aeroways.css index 7598949d3..1182b00e7 100644 --- a/css/35_aeroways.css +++ b/css/35_aeroways.css @@ -1,10 +1,11 @@ /* aeroways */ /* areas */ -path.stroke.area.tag-aeroway { - stroke:#fff; +path.stroke.area.tag-aeroway, +.low-zoom path.stroke.area.tag-aeroway { + stroke: #fff; stroke-dasharray: none; - stroke-width: 2; + stroke-width: 1; } /* narrow aeroways (taxiway) */ diff --git a/css/40_railways.css b/css/40_railways.css index 4649ae2ea..2e3575669 100644 --- a/css/40_railways.css +++ b/css/40_railways.css @@ -9,6 +9,20 @@ fill: #eee; } +/* railway areas */ + +path.stroke.area.tag-railway, +.low-zoom path.stroke.area.tag-railway { + stroke: white; + stroke-width: 1; + stroke-dasharray: none; +} + +path.casing.area.tag-railway, +.low-zoom path.casing.area.tag-railway { + stroke: none; +} + /* narrow widths */ path.shadow.tag-railway { @@ -70,21 +84,39 @@ path.stroke.tag-railway-subway { } +/* railway platforms - like sidewalks */ + +path.shadow.tag-railway-platform { + stroke-width: 16; +} path.casing.tag-railway-platform { - stroke: none; + stroke: #fff; + stroke-width: 5; + stroke-linecap: round; + stroke-dasharray: none; } path.stroke.tag-railway-platform { - stroke: #999; - stroke-width: 4; - stroke-dasharray: none; + stroke: #ae8681; + stroke-width: 3; + stroke-linecap: butt; + stroke-dasharray: 6, 6; } - -.area.stroke.tag-railway { - stroke: white; +.low-zoom path.shadow.tag-railway-platform { + stroke-width: 12; +} +.low-zoom path.casing.tag-railway-platform { + stroke-width: 3; +} +.low-zoom path.stroke.tag-railway-platform { stroke-width: 1; - stroke-dasharray: none; + stroke-linecap: butt; + stroke-dasharray: 3, 3; } -.area.casing.tag-railway { - stroke: none; + +g.midpoint.tag-railway-platform .fill { + fill: #fff; + stroke: #333; + stroke-opacity: .8; + opacity: .8; }